\displaystyle\\\lim_{x\to 0}\dfrac{\sqrt{4+5x}-2}{x}=\\\\\lim_{x\to 0}\dfrac{(\sqrt{4+5x}-2)(\sqrt{4+5x}+2)}{x(\sqrt{4+5x}+2)}=\\\\\lim_{x\to 0}\dfrac{4+5x-4}{x(\sqrt{4+5x}+2)}=\\\\\lim_{x\to 0}\dfrac{5x}{x(\sqrt{4+5x}+2)}=\\\\\lim_{x\to 0}\dfrac{5}{\sqrt{4+5x}+2}=\\\\\dfrac{5}{\sqrt{4+5\cdot 0}+2}=\dfrac{5}{2+2}=\dfrac{5}{4}
